Output 0ed7bdf1a51d7407752d48e90e8f25ca7756f5ffdae53c7cb7c3e9e4778eb8a3:3

value
18564986
script pubkey
OP_0 OP_PUSHBYTES_32 1056faccf8f29c231886d1d28060fe13efead141f9394c3b5bbabece91159f63
address
bc1qzpt04n8c72wzxxyx68fgqc87z0h7452plyu5cw6mh2lvayg4na3s4ex587
transaction
0ed7bdf1a51d7407752d48e90e8f25ca7756f5ffdae53c7cb7c3e9e4778eb8a3
confirmations
299936
spent
true